Socket网络这块很重要的是指定ip地址,端口号等基本信息。这些信息被封装在InetAddress中,所以先上一个小Demo介绍InetAddress的几个基本方法。

InetAddress入门Demo

    public static void main(String[] args) throws UnknownHostException {
        // TODO Auto-generated method stub

        // 获取本地主机的IP地址对象
        //InetAddress inet = InetAddress.getLocalHost();

        //获取任意一台主机的ip地址对象
        InetAddress  inet = InetAddress.getByName("www.baidu.com");

        // 获取ip地址
        String address = inet.getHostAddress();

        // 获取主机名
        String name = inet.getHostName();

        System.out.println(name + ":" + address);

    }

使用 Tcp 协议实现客户端给服务器端发送数据

TcpClient

    /**
     * 使用 Tcp 协议实现客户端给服务器端发送数据
     * 1:创建Socket端点,同时指明连接的服务器和端口
     * 2:使用Socket的发送功能发送数据
     * @throws IOException 
     * @throws UnknownHostException 
     */
    public static void main(String[] args) throws UnknownHostException, IOException {
        System.out.println("客户端启动......");
        //创建Socket客户端端点,同时指明连接的服务器和端口
        //这条语句执行成功,说明客户端对象创建成功,同时说明和服务器端连接成功
        //如果连接成功,说明和服务器端建立了一条通道
        //这条通道就是 Socket流(就是Socket客户端对象),这个Socket流中既有字节输入流,也有字节输出流
        Socket s = new Socket(InetAddress.getByName("192.168.1.212"),55555);


        //向服务器端发送数据
        //发送数据就是输出---从 Socket流中获取输出流
        OutputStream out = s.getOutputStream();

        //发送数据
        out.write("哥们,你好".getBytes());

        //接收数据
        InputStream in = s.getInputStream();
        byte[] arr = new byte[1024];
        int len =in.read(arr);
        System.out.println(new String(arr,0,len));

        s.close();
    }

TcpServer

    /**
     * 使用 Tcp实现服务器端
     * 1:创建 Socket端点,同时监听端口
     * 2:
     * @throws IOException 
     */
    public static void main(String[] args) throws IOException {
        System.out.println("服务器端启动......");
        //1:创建 Socket端点,同时监听端口
        ServerSocket  ss = new ServerSocket(55555);

        //得到客户端对象,也就是得到客户端使用的 Socket流,从而和客户端使用同一个流
        Socket s = ss.accept();
        System.out.println(s.getInetAddress().getHostAddress()+"连接到服务器端......");

        //接收客户端发送的数据
        //接收就是读取
        InputStream in = s.getInputStream();

        byte[] arr = new byte[1024];
        int len = in.read(arr);
        System.out.println(new String(arr,0,len));

        //向客户端发送数据
        OutputStream out = s.getOutputStream();
        out.write("你好,哥们".getBytes());

        s.close();
        ss.close();
    }

一个大写转换服务器Demo

客户端接收键盘输入的小写字符串,发送给服务器端,服务器端接收到小写字符串,转成大写,再发送给客户端

TextChangeClient

     /** 
     * 客户端:
     *  1:接收键盘输入的小写字符串
     *  2:发送小写字符串
     *  3:接收大写字符串
     * @throws IOException 
     * @throws UnknownHostException 
     */
    public static void main(String[] args) throws UnknownHostException, IOException {
        System.out.println("客户端启动....");
         //创建客户端对象
        Socket s = new Socket(InetAddress.getByName("192.168.1.212"),23333);

        //创建读取键盘输入的小写字符串的字符读取流
        BufferedReader br = new BufferedReader(new InputStreamReader(System.in));

        //创建发送小写字符串的字符输出流
        OutputStream out = s.getOutputStream();
        PrintWriter pw = new PrintWriter(out,true);

        //创建接收大写字符串的字符读取流 
        InputStream in = s.getInputStream();
        BufferedReader bin = new BufferedReader(new InputStreamReader(in));


        //循环读取键盘输入的数据,发送给服务器端,并接收返回的大写字符串
        String line = null;
        while((line = br.readLine())!=null) {
            if("over".equals(line))
                break;
            pw.println(line);//发送给服务器端
            System.out.println(bin.readLine());//接收返回的大写字符串
        }

        br.close();
        s.close();

    }

TextChangeServer

    /**               
     * 服务器端:
     * 接收小写字符串
     * 发送大写字符串
     * @throws IOException 
     */
    public static void main(String[] args) throws IOException {
        System.out.println("服务器端启动....");
        ServerSocket ss = new ServerSocket(23333);

        //得到客户端对象
        Socket s = ss.accept();
        System.out.println(s.getInetAddress().getHostAddress()+"连接到 服务器端.....");

        //创建接收小写字符串的字符读取流
        InputStream in = s.getInputStream();
        BufferedReader br = new BufferedReader(new InputStreamReader(in));

        //创建发送大写字符串的字符输出流
        OutputStream out = s.getOutputStream();
        PrintWriter pw = new PrintWriter(out,true);

        String line = null;
        while((line = br.readLine())!=null)//循环读取客户端
        {
            pw.println(line.toUpperCase());
        }

        s.close();
    }

文本文件的上传的客户端Demo

客户端读取本地文件发送给服务器端,服务器端读取客户端,写入到服务器端的某个文件,服务器端返回”上传成功”

FileUploadClient

    /**
     * 客户端:
     * 1:读取本地文件
     * 2:发送给服务器端
     * 3:读取服务器端返回的"上传成功"
     * @throws IOException 
     * @throws UnknownHostException 
     */
    public static void main(String[] args) throws UnknownHostException, IOException {

        System.out.println("客户端启动.....");

        Socket s = new Socket(InetAddress.getByName("192.168.1.212"),24444);

        //创建读取本地文件的字符读取流
        BufferedReader br = new BufferedReader(new FileReader("temp\\tcptext.txt"));

        //创建 向服务器端发送数据的字符输出流
        OutputStream out = s.getOutputStream();
        PrintWriter pw = new PrintWriter(out,true);

        //创建读取服务器端返回的"上传成功"的字符读取流
        InputStream in = s.getInputStream();
        BufferedReader brr =  new BufferedReader(new InputStreamReader(in));

        //循环读取文件,发送到服务器端
        String line = null;
        while((line = br.readLine())!=null) {
            pw.println(line);
        }
        //向服务器端写入结束标记
        s.shutdownOutput();

        //读取服务器端返回的"上传成功"
        String result = brr.readLine();

        System.out.println(result);

        br.close();
        s.close();

    }

FileUploadServer

    /**          
     * 服务器端:
     * 接收客户端发送的数据
     * 写入到本地文件
     * 发送“上传成功”
     * @throws IOException 
     */
    public static void main(String[] args) throws IOException {
        System.out.println("服务器端启动....");
        ServerSocket ss = new ServerSocket(24444);

        Socket s = ss.accept();
        System.out.println(s.getInetAddress().getHostAddress()+"连接到服务器端.....");

        //创建接收客户端发送的数据字符读取流
        InputStream in = s.getInputStream();
        BufferedReader br = new BufferedReader(new InputStreamReader(in));

        //创建写入到本地文件的字符输出流
        PrintWriter pw = new PrintWriter(new FileWriter("temp\\tcptext_copy.txt"),true);

        //创建发送“上传成功”的字符输出流
        OutputStream out = s.getOutputStream();
        PrintWriter pww = new PrintWriter(out,true);

        //循环读取客户端,写入到本地文件
        String line = null;
        while((line = br.readLine())!=null) {//读不到null
            pw.println(line);
        }

        pw.close();

        //发送上传成功
        pww.println("上传成功");

        s.close();
    }

图片上传的客户端Demo

PicUploadClient

    /**
     * 图片上传的客户端:
     * @throws IOException 
     * @throws UnknownHostException 
     * 
     */
    public static void main(String[] args) throws UnknownHostException, IOException {

          System.out.println("客户端启动.....");

          Socket s = new Socket(InetAddress.getByName("192.168.1.212"),25555);

          FileInputStream fis = new FileInputStream("temp\\tu.jpg");

          OutputStream out = s.getOutputStream();

          InputStream in = s.getInputStream();

          byte[] arr = new byte[1024];
          int len = 0;
          while((len = fis.read(arr))!=-1) {
              out.write(arr,0,len);
          }

          s.shutdownOutput();//写入结束标记

          //读取“上传成功”
          byte[] b = new byte[1024];
          int num = in.read(b);
          System.out.println(new String(b,0,num));

          fis.close();
          s.close(); 
    }

PicUploadServer

    /**
     *  图片上传的服务器端:
     * @throws IOException 
     */
    public static void main(String[] args) throws IOException {

        System.out.println("服务器端启动....");
        ServerSocket ss = new ServerSocket(25555);

        Socket s = ss.accept();
        System.out.println(s.getInetAddress().getHostAddress()+"连接到服务器端......");

        InputStream in = s.getInputStream();

        FileOutputStream fos = new FileOutputStream("temp\\tu_copy.jpg");

        OutputStream out = s.getOutputStream();

        //循环读取客户端数据,写入到本地文件
        byte[] arr = new byte[1024];
        int len = 0;
        while((len = in.read(arr))!=-1)
        {
            fos.write(arr,0,len);
        }
        fos.close();

        out.write("上传成功".getBytes());

        s.close();

    }

图片的并发上传Demo

PicUploadClient

同上

PicUploads

public class PicUploads implements Runnable {

    private Socket socket;
    public PicUploads(Socket socket) {
        this.socket = socket;
    }

    @Override
    public void run() {

          //所有上传的图片放到同一个目录下
          File dir = new File("f:\\tupian");
          if(!dir.exists())
              dir.mkdir();

          String ip = socket.getInetAddress().getHostAddress();
          System.out.println(ip+"连接到服务器端....");

          int num = 0;
          File file = new File(dir,ip+"("+(++num)+")"+".jpg");

          while(file.exists()) {
              file = new File(dir,ip+"("+(++num)+")"+".jpg");
          }

          try {

            InputStream in = socket.getInputStream();
            FileOutputStream fos = new FileOutputStream(file);

            byte[] arr = new byte[1024];
            int len = 0;
            while((len = in.read(arr))!=-1) {
                fos.write(arr,0,len);
            }
            fos.close();

            OutputStream out = socket.getOutputStream();
            out.write("上传成功".getBytes());

            socket.close();
        } catch (IOException e) {
            e.printStackTrace();
        }
    }

}

PicUploadServer

    /**
     * @param args
     * @throws IOException 
     */
    public static void main(String[] args) throws IOException {

        ServerSocket ss = new ServerSocket(25555);
        while(true) {
            Socket socket = ss.accept();
            new Thread(new PicUploads(socket)).start();
        }
    }
